Q: What are 4 observations of a chemical change?

How is a student able to conclude that a chemical reaction occurred?

Some observations: - change of colour - formation of a precipitate - change of odor - change of temperature - release of a gas - change of pH - change of viscosity etc.


What are the five observations of chemistry that shows that a chemical reaction have taken place?

Formation of a precipitate; change in color; change in temperature; formation of a gas; emission of light.

What can be used to describe a chemical change?

A chemical equation can be used to describe a chemical change. For instance when iron combines with oxygen to form iron (III) oxide (rust), a chemical change has occurred. It can be written as a chemical formula: 4 Fe + 3 O2 --> 2 Fe2O3
